Pietracamela, Abruzzo, Italy
Overview
Pietracamela is a picturesque mountain village in Abruzzo, set beneath the imposing Gran Sasso d'Italia. Known for its well-preserved medieval charm and as a base for outdoor adventure, it offers a quiet escape immersed in nature.
Best Time to Visit
May-October for hiking and outdoor activities; December-March for skiing.
Local Tips
Bring cash, as some small establishments may not accept credit cards. The area is best explored on foot due to limited local transport.
Cultural Etiquette
Greet locals with a friendly 'buongiorno.' Tipping is appreciated but not obligatory; a few coins in cafes/restaurants is polite.
Safety Warnings
Generally very safe; just beware of mountain weather changes when hiking and ensure you have proper gear.
Hidden Gems
Seek out the ancient stone fountains, visit the tiny Church of San Giovanni, and follow local shepherd trails for panoramic views many tourists miss.
